Set Initial Conditions (SIC) Command Section 2 The SIC command sets the printer to the default values that were set at the factory or to user-defined defaults. SIC Command Format Use the following format: Format ESC [ K Decimal 27 91 75 Hex 1B 5B 4B Ln Hn init ID p1...p22 Ln Hn Ln Hn Ln is the number of parameters plus 2. Hn is 0. The decimal and hexadecimal digits for the printer command appear below the printer command format. 21 Section 2: Set Initial Conditions (SIC) Command
